117.info
人生若只如初见

docker如何修改mysql配置

您可以通过以下步骤来修改Docker中MySQL的配置:

  1. 首先,停止正在运行的MySQL容器,可以使用以下命令:

    docker stop 
    
  2. 使用以下命令创建一个新的MySQL容器,并将其连接到一个数据卷:

    docker run -d -p 3306:3306 --name=mysql -v /my/custom:/etc/mysql/conf.d -e MYSQL_ROOT_PASSWORD= mysql:tag
    

    其中,/my/custom是您本地主机上的自定义配置文件目录。您可以将其替换为您想要使用的目录。是MySQL的root密码,mysql:tag是您所需的MySQL映像和标签。

  3. 在自定义配置文件目录中创建一个新的配置文件,例如custom.cnf。您可以使用任何文本编辑器来创建并编辑该文件。

  4. custom.cnf文件中添加您想要修改的配置选项。例如,如果您想要修改MySQL的字符集配置,您可以添加以下内容:

    [mysqld]
    character_set_server=utf8mb4
    collation_server=utf8mb4_unicode_ci
    
  5. 保存并关闭文件。

  6. 启动MySQL容器:

    docker start 
    

现在,您已经成功修改了MySQL容器的配置。您可以通过连接到MySQL容器并运行SHOW VARIABLES命令来验证更改是否已生效。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e64bAzsLBQZSDVc.html

推荐文章

  • docker部署mysql的优缺点有哪些

    Docker部署MySQL的优点有:1. 简化部署:使用Docker容器可以快速地部署MySQL数据库,无需手动安装和配置。2. 隔离性:每个MySQL容器都是独立的,互不干扰,可以避...

  • docker启动mysql失败如何处理

    首先,您可以检查以下事项来解决Docker启动MySQL失败的问题: 检查Docker是否已正确安装并正在运行。您可以通过运行docker version命令来检查Docker的版本和状态...

  • docker怎么启动mysql容器

    要启动MySQL容器,您可以按照以下步骤操作: 首先,确保您已经安装了Docker。可以在终端或命令提示符下运行docker -v命令来检查是否已安装Docker,并查看其版本。...

  • docker怎么连接外部mysql

    要连接外部MySQL,您可以使用Docker的网络功能,并通过网络连接到外部MySQL服务器。
    以下是一些步骤: 在Docker中创建一个网络(如果还没有):
    docke...

  • linux怎么查看磁盘io使用情况

    要查看Linux系统中磁盘IO使用情况,可以使用命令行工具iostat。以下是使用iostat命令的方法: 打开终端。
    输入以下命令: iostat -d -k 该命令将显示每个磁...

  • ubuntu如何查看所有磁盘

    在Ubuntu中,可以通过以下命令来查看所有磁盘: 打开终端。
    运行以下命令: sudo fdisk -l 这将列出所有已连接到计算机的磁盘和分区。请注意,需要使用管理...

  • linux共享文件夹怎么设置

    在Linux中,可以通过使用Samba或NFS来共享文件夹。
    使用Samba共享文件夹的步骤如下: 安装Samba软件包:在终端中运行以下命令安装Samba软件包:sudo apt-ge...

  • hadoop集群搭建的原理是什么

    Hadoop是一个分布式计算框架,其集群搭建的原理是将大规模的数据和计算任务分布式存储和处理。
    Hadoop集群搭建的主要原理包括以下几个方面: 分布式存储:H...